The Dark OnesCreatures born of hatred, born of vengeance, born of lust, The creatures born of silence, and of passion without trust, They poison peace,The Dark Ones
Lurking in the shadows of a harrowed soul, On the dark side of the moon, These daemons take their toll, They laugh at the broken dreams whispered in the wind, They tease reflections of the faces of those who have sinned, Those who do, scream and sob all that they can, But these creatures, all of them, they were born of man...
